Subfloor Joist Replacement in Wilmington, NC
Subfloor joist replacement services involve removing and replacing damaged or rotted wooden beams that support the flooring system in a home. This type of project is commonly needed when there are signs of sagging floors, creaking noises, or visible damage underneath the flooring. Property owners often request this service during home renovations, repairs after water damage, or when preparing for new flooring installations, ensuring the foundation beneath the floor remains stable and secure.
Homeowners should understand that replacing subfloor joists typically requires careful assessment of the extent of damage and the type of materials used in the existing structure. It’s important to consider factors such as the age of the property, the severity of the damage, and whether additional repairs are necessary to prevent future issues. Contacting a professional can help determine the appropriate approach and ensure the work is performed safely and effectively to maintain the integrity of the home’s flooring system.

Subfloor Joist Replacement Questions
What are subfloor joists? Subfloor joists are the structural supports that hold up the flooring above, providing stability and support for the entire floor system.
When should subfloor joists be replaced? Replacement is recommended when joists are damaged, rotted, or compromised by pests, affecting the safety and integrity of the flooring.
What signs indicate subfloor joist issues? Common signs include sagging floors, creaking sounds, uneven surfaces, or visible damage beneath the flooring.
How does subfloor joist replacement improve a property? Replacing damaged joists restores floor stability, prevents further structural issues, and helps maintain a safe, level living space.
